Sometimes a bathroom doesn’t necessarily need a full gut remodel. Perhaps the prior homeowner did a renovation a few years ago, or maybe you have a newly built home but it’s pretty builder basic. New construction homes that are not custom often lack the detail and finish that really give a home personality and style. My bathroom fell into this category. I could see it had so much more potential to be a really lovely, fresh, and elegant space that I’d want to get ready in every morning and end my day in. A few strategic and choiceful updates will give your bathroom new life and make it a space you really love.

SELECTING THE WALLPAPER

I decided wallpaper was going to be the design feature in this bathroom, so it was important to choose one that I loved and wouldn’t get tired of. Wallpaper feels like a pretty big commitment, but it can be a beautiful statement. Today, there are so many beautiful, modern, and timeless wallpaper patterns and colors to choose from. 

Based on the look I was going for I focused on small repeat patterns that were classic but not too busy in a light and neutral color palette. This is the wallpaper I chose:

ADDRESSING THE NICHES

The niches over the bathtub are pretty large, and I thought they looked unfinished when just left empty and painted. So I tiled them with marble hexagon tile. To really complete the niches I installed custom glass shelves to provide a place for personalized decor and pretty bath items, making it a lot more functional than it was before.

CHOOSING THE BATHROOM HARDWARE

Replacing bathroom hardware like towel bars and rings and, in my case, adding more bathroom hardware like robe hooks is an easy update to achieve a different style or complement the rest of the updates and provide much needed function. I wanted hardware that looked classic and timeless, but still current. 
I liked the design of the Pottery Barn Pearson Hardware & Fixture Collection. It has a classic style, but the square base and straighter lines makes it more modern and masculine which balances out the feminine features of the bathroom.

How to Decorate and Style a Bathroom

Lastly, styling the bathroom is as important for a finished look as other rooms in the house. In my newly updated bathroom I didn’t want to get bath accessories that looked like bath accessories. I wanted the decor to be personalized and not matchy-matchy just like how I would decorate other rooms in my house. Except all the stores would have you believe that you really need the bar soap dish, the liquid soap dispenser, the tissue box holder, and the toothbrush holder to match your shower curtain and bath mat. No, we don’t want that.

Instead, I thought about my bathroom the way I would think about my living room or bedroom.

Tip 1

To create a cohesive look I stuck to a neutral and light color palette of silver, white, and watery blues. I brought in silver frames with photos for a personal touch. I used sea-inspired, blue glass vases and soaps for a calm and spa-like feel.

Tip 2

I paid attention to the materials and texture of the décor. The glass shelves and accessories keep it light and airy, reflect light, and let the marble tiles show through. White towels add softness to a space with a lot of hard and cold materials. Glass jars display pretty bathroom items and keep them tidy.

Tip 3

I brought in a natural touch with flowers like orchids and peonies, taking into consideration the type of flower and how it adds to the design. Orchids are luxurious and glamorous flowers. They also last a long time, especially in the humid bathroom environment. The peonies feel feminine and soft with their layers of petals. The white is consistent with the color palette. These ones in particular are low maintenance because they are faux!
